How former Jayhawks fared in NBA games of Jan. 4

By Staff Reports     Jan 5, 2014

Mario Chalmers, Miami Heat (W, 110-94 at ORL)

9 points (4-6 FG, 1-3 3PG), 6 rebounds, 2 steals, 2 turnovers in 29 minutes

Kirk Hinrich, Chicago Bulls (W, 91-84 vs. ATL)

5 points (2-3 FG, 1-2 3PG), 2 rebounds, 2 assists, 1 steal in 20 minutes

Ben McLemore, Sacramento Kings (L, 113-103 vs. CHA)

5 points (2-8 FG, 1-4 3PG), 3 rebounds, 1 block, 1 turnover in 22 minutes

Tyshawn Taylor, Brooklyn Nets (W, 89-82 vs. CLE)

0 points (no FGA/FTA) in 14 seconds

Nick Collison, Oklahoma City Thunder (W, 115-111 at MIN)

8 points (4-6 FG), 3 rebounds, 1 assist, 1 steal, 1 block, 1 turnover in 23 minutes

Marcus Morris, Phoenix Suns (W, 116-100 vs. MIL)

7 points (3-12 FG, 1-4 3PG), 5 rebounds, 1 assist, 1 turnover in 30 minutes

Markieff Morris, Phoenix Suns (W, 116-100 vs. MIL)

14 points (5-6 FG, 4-4 FT), 5 rebounds, 2 assists, 1 steal, 1 turnover in 26 minutes

Paul Pierce, Brooklyn Nets (W, 89-82 vs. CLE)

17 points (6-14 FG, 2-6 3PG, 3-3 FT), 2 rebounds, 5 assists, 1 steal, 3 blocks, 3 turnovers in 34 minutes

Thomas Robinson, Portland Trail Blazers (L, 101-99 vs. PHI)

Did not play (coach’s decision)

Jeff Withey, New Orleans Pelicans (L, 99-82 at IND)

0 points (no FGA/FTA), 1 rebound in 4 minutes

How former Jayhawks fared in Jan. 4 NBA games

By Staff     Jan 4, 2013

Cole Aldrich, Houston Rockets (W, 115-101 vs. MIL)

0 points (0-1 FG), 2 rebounds in 3 minutes

Darrell Arthur, Memphis Grizzlies (L, 86-84 vs. POR)

10 points (5-10 FG), 5 rebounds, 1 steal in 21 minutes

Mario Chalmers, Miami Heat (L, 96-89 vs. CHI)

5 points (2-6 FG, 1-3 3P), 1 rebound, 3 assists, 1 steal, 1 turnover in 25 minutes

Nick Collison, Oklahoma City Thunder (W, 109-85 vs. PHI)

6 points (3-5 FG), 3 rebounds, 3 assists, 1 steal in 23 minutes

Drew Gooden, Milwaukee Bucks (L, 115-101 vs. HOU)

Did not play (coach’s decision)

Kirk?Hinrich, Chicago Bulls (W, 96-89 vs. MIA)

10 points (3-8 FG, 2-5 3P, 2-2 FT), 4 rebounds, 8 assists, 1 steal, 1 block, 3 turnovers in 29 minutes

Marcus Morris, Houston Rockets (W, 115-101 vs. MIL)

0 points (0-7 FG, 0-4 3P), 7 rebounds, 2 assists, 1 block in 25 minutes

Markieff Morris, Phoenix Suns (L, 87-80 vs. UTA)

2 points (1-7 FG, 0-2 3P), 3 rebounds, 1 assist, 2 blocks in 12 minutes

Paul Pierce, Boston Celtics (W, 94-75 vs. IND)

13 points (5-10 FG, 2-3 3P, 1-3 FT), 6 rebounds, 5 assists, 1 steal, 1 block in 29 minutes

Thomas Robinson, Sacramento Kings (W, 105-96 vs. TOR)

5 points (2-3 FG, 1-3 FT), 4 rebounds, 3 assists, 1 steal in 23 minutes

Josh Selby, Memphis Grizzlies (L, 86-84 vs. POR)

Did not play (coach’s decision)

Tyshawn Taylor, Brooklyn Nets (W, 115-113 2OT vs. WAS)

0 points (0-2 FT), 2 turnovers in 3 minutes
